Summary

Researchers identified key proteins linked to aggressive breast cancer metastasis. Leucine-rich repeat containing 59 (LRRC59) correlated with aggressiveness, while CD59 and chondroitin sulfate proteoglycan 4 (CSPG4) showed inverse correlation.
